7/5/2012 - SPANGDAHLEM AIR BASE, Germany – Kate Julazadeh throws a ball to dunk her husband, Col. David Julazadeh, 52nd Fighter Wing commander, during Super Saber Appreciation Day at the base pavilion near the Eifel Lanes Bowling Center July 4. The event included a number of activities including pony rides, a carousel and swings, and two bouncy castles were available for younger children. The 52nd Force Support Squadron sponsored the event to celebrate Independence Day and show appreciation to the 52nd FW community.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Matthew B. Fredericks/Released)
